Band of Brothers - A Must-own Set!

by   drdevience ,   Jan 20, 2003

Pros:  Everything

Cons:  not a one

The Bottom Line:  I think absolutely every person alive should see this one!

Overall Rating: 5/5 stars
 

Author's Review

I never liked war fliks. OK.. I did like Blackhawk Down and Three Kings, I'm sure there's a few others I might admit to liking thru the years..but over-all if ya put a war movie in I'm bound to groan....loudly. So it was when Nick brought home Band of Brothers the other day. He dislikes war movies too, so I was like WTF?? Well.. it normally sells for $79.99 at Best buy, but was on sale, plus he had a 10% off coupon...and some friends at work had recommended it. I rolled my eyes and we popped it in... and it was me who kept us up all hours of the night with pleas of just one more episode pleaaase?

Hooked. Majorly. This is a mini-series which originaly aired on HBO and I'm telling you now.. whether you hate war movies or not, you must buy this set! Based on the book by Stephen Ambrose, It is the story of WWII, more specifically, the 101st Airborne division..the first Airborn guys ever. This is the true (but slightly modified for dramatic effect) tale of what these guys went thru and how they became so close. From the parachuting into Normandy to the taking of Hitler's Eagles Nest estate, this set will draw you in like no other. You see, it's about the war, yes, but more importantly, it's about this group of guys that went thru soooo much incredible crap! Their bravery and dedication is just awe inspiring.

At the beginning of each episode you get to see the real guys who were there talking about the war. These are some of the guys in the movie. There is also an additional disc at the end that is them talking about it and the reunions they have to this day.

David Frankel and Tom Hanks are the directors and masterminds behind this amazing piece of cinema, along with input and backing from Steven Speilberg. What an awesome job they did! They used mostly unknown actors for this, and got performances out of them that are just downright stellar. I wouldn't be surprised to see every last one of them go on to the big leagues after this.

Every single actor involved in this endeavor was completely and utterly believable. They brought you there, you felt thier pain and thier triumphs with them. At one point Nick wanted to go to bed and I was like No! we can't leave them there in those woods all night! We kept watching.

The Cast
Damian Lewis .... Maj. Richard D. Winters
Donnie Wahlberg .... 2nd Lt. C. Carwood Lipton
Ron Livingston .... Capt. Lewis Nixon
Matthew Settle .... Capt. Ronald Speirs
Rick Warden .... 1st Lt. Harry Welsh
Frank John Hughes .... SSgt. William 'Wild Bill' Guarnere
Scott Grimes .... TSgt. Donald Malarkey
Neal McDonough .... 1st Lt. Lynn 'Buck' Compton
Rick Gomez .... Sgt. George Luz
Eion Bailey .... Pvt. David Kenyon Webster
James Madio .... Sgt. Frank Perconte
Kirk Acevedo .... SSgt. Joseph Toye
Michael Cudlitz .... Sgt. Denver 'Bull' Randleman
Richard Speight Jr. .... Sgt. Warren 'Skip' Muck
Dexter Fletcher .... SSgt. John Martin

Donnie Wahlberg isn't so much an unknown, as a guy who was better known as a musician from his days in New Kids On The Block. I remember him well since my daughter had her entire bedroom just plastered with posters of them! During that time he brought his little brother Mark into the biz .. as Marky Mark... and Mark Wahlberg later got into movies..and now Donnie has followed him there. Donnie shoulda started out here. He did a fantastic job in this movie.

Neal McDonough is the only other person I recognized in this. You may recall him from Star Trek: First Contact and as Gordon Fletcher in Minority Report. A very good actor, and a standing-ovation kinda job in this one in particular!

This DVD is 5 discs long, with 2 episodes on each disc. There is a 6th disc with the actual guys who were portrayed in the movie. It was great fun seeing who was who. Each Episode is about an hour long, for a total run time of about 600 minutes. Start early and watch it all the way thru. Trust me, you won't want to wait til the next day to finish it!

The scenes were shot mostly at the actual locations of the original battles. You can't get more accurate than that!

I cannot find a rating on this set, but there is a lot of violence and gore that looks very real..but it's a war movie! It has to have all that. ok.. 13 and up, depending on your kid. How's that?

I recommend this set very highly. It is moving, and like I said, it just puts you right there with the guys. It's rare these days to get total immersion, this one does pulls it off. This is a series you will want to watch more than once. Most definitely an owner!
